Fixed point simd
WebSo, we have 16 SIMD threads / block, with 32 elements / thread. An SIMD instruction executes 32 elements at a time . Therefore, the grid size is 16 blocks, where a block is analogous to a strip-mined vector loop with vector length of 32. A block is assigned to a multithreaded SIMD processor by the thread block scheduler. http://www.ece.uah.edu/~jovanov/CPE495/notes/msp430_filter.pdf
Fixed point simd
Did you know?
WebFixed point is widely used in DSP and embedded-systems where often the target processor has no FPU, and fixed point can be implemented reasonably efficiently using an integer … WebBy selectively using the advanced fixed-point instruction set and the floating-point instruction set, the programmer can achieve significantly higher performance for their algorithm in terms of data precision and optimized cycle count.
WebMaratyszcza Port fixedpoint header to WebAssembly SIMD ( #202) Latest commit 13d5770 on Jan 13, 2024 History. 10 contributors. 914 lines (806 sloc) 34.9 KB. Raw Blame. // … In computing, fixed-point is a method of representing fractional (non-integer) numbers by storing a fixed number of digits of their fractional part. Dollar amounts, for example, are often stored with exactly two fractional digits, representing the cents (1/100 of dollar). More generally, the term may refer to … See more A fixed-point representation of a fractional number is essentially an integer that is to be implicitly multiplied by a fixed scaling factor. For example, the value 1.23 can be stored in a variable as the integer value 1230 with implicit … See more Addition and subtraction To add or subtract two values with the same implicit scaling factor, it is sufficient to add or subtract … See more Explicit support for fixed-point numbers is provided by a few computer languages, notably PL/I, COBOL, Ada, JOVIAL, and Coral 66. They provide fixed-point data types, … See more Various notations have been used to concisely specify the parameters of a fixed-point format. In the following list, f represents the number of fractional bits, m the number of … See more A common use of decimal fixed-point is for storing monetary values, for which the complicated rounding rules of floating-point numbers are often a liability. For example, the open source money management application GnuCash, written in C, switched from … See more Scaling and renormalization Typical processors do not have specific support for fixed-point arithmetic. However, most computers with binary arithmetic have fast bit shift instructions that can multiply or divide an integer by any power of 2; in … See more Decimal fixed point multiplication Suppose there is the following multiplication with 2 fixed point 3 decimal place numbers. See more
Web32-Bit Fixed-Point Multipliers with 64-Bit Product & 80-Bit Accumulation; No Arithmetic Pipeline; All Computations Are Single-Cycle ... (100MHz / 600MFLOPs) offered by utilizing a Single-Instruction, Multiple-Data (SIMD) architecture. This hardware extension to first generation SHARC processors doubles the number of computational resources ... WebThis instruction converts a scalar or each element in a vector from floating-point to fixed-point signed integer using the Round towards Zero rounding mode, and writes the result …
WebSIMD & VLIW programming, Fixed & Floating point DSP Architectures • Operating Systems - Ubuntu, Windows and MacOS • Perforce, github, SVN tortoise, Clear Case Specialties: Artificial ...
Webfixed-point: [adjective] involving or being a mathematical notation (as in a decimal system) in which the point separating whole numbers and fractions is fixed — compare floating … two harbors mn city council agendaWebSpecify Fixed-Point Data Types. Simulink ® allows you to create models that use fixed-point numbers to represent signals and parameter values. Use of fixed-point data can … two harbors mn city councilWebExtended-Precision Fixed-Point Arithmetic on SIMD SHARC® Processors (EE-270) Page 2 of 9 representation when initializing DATA64 memory, VisualDSP++ truncates any other … two harbors mn city council meetingsWebFixed point filter implementation • Microcontrollers emulate floating point operations – Running fixed point operations much faster – The precision may not be sufficient for some applications – Example ffilt.c on our web-site • Representing floating point numbers using fixed point values (arithmetic operations) •Assume: two harbors mn electric companyWebVCVT (between floating-point and integer, Advanced SIMD) VCVT, VCVTR (between floating-point and integer, Floating-point) VCVT (between floating-point and fixed … two harbors mn chamber of commerceWebJan 9, 2015 · This is the beginning of a 5-part series of articles on how to write some quick integer and fixed point math in assembly language for the Cortex-M3, Cortex-M4 and Cortex-M7 microcontrollers. Introduction. This article will familiarize you with basic 32-bit math operations, such as addition, subtraction ,multiplication, division, bitwise AND ... two harbors lighthouse hotelWebAug 29, 2004 · It is connected to ARM-10 main processor through the co-processor interface and can perform general integer and fixed-point SIMD arithmetic operations and 3-D graphics functions such as geometry ... talking tom hero descargar